Physical DescriptionOriginal cartoon drawing. LBJ turns off a pipeline ("National Origin Quotas") into a huge container ("USA Melting Pot"). He yells at a man ready to turn on another pipeline ("Talents, Skills, Family Quotas"). Caption: “Now Turn That One On”. Artist signature lower left: "Ivey S.F. Examiner”.
Inscriptions and MarkingsHandwritten at lower right: “595”. Handwritten at upper right: [blue] “Edit” [illegible] “3 cols”.
Historical NoteThe Immigration Act of 1965 abolished immigration quotas by country, prioritized relatives of US citizens, skilled workers, and permanent residents.
